An Epiphone Icon
Hailed by blues legend John Lee Hooker as “an out-did 335,” the Sheraton has been renown for decades for its combination of superior tone and beautiful pearloid and abalone inlay. Originally released in 1959, the inspiration for the “thin-line” or ES series has its roots in Les Paul’s first solidbody guitar, “The Log,” that Les built in Epiphone’s factory in Manhattan in 1940. “The Log” was made from Epiphone parts with a 4″ x 4″ piece of Pinewood down the middle. The ES-series is also semi-hollow with a solid center, which makes it more resistant to feedback than a typical archtop guitar.
SPECIFICATIONS
Body Wood
Laminated Maple
Top Wood
Laminated Maple
Neck
5-pc Hard Maple/Walnut Laminated
Neck Shape
1960’s SlimTaper™
Neck Joint
Glued-in, set
Scale
24.75″
Fingerboard
Rosewood with “block and triangle” inlays/Pearloid and Abalone
Fingerboard Radius
12″
Nut
Graphtech® NuBone XL
Nut Width
1.68″
Frets
22 medium jumbo
Binding
Top: 5-ply (Ivory/Black)Back: 1-ply (Ivory)Neck: 5-ply (Ivory/Black)Headstock: 5-ply (Ivory/Black)”f” Holes: 1-ply (Ivory/Black)
Headstock
Vintage “Large Clipped Ear” with Mother of Pearl “Vine” Inlay
Neck Pickup
ProBucker-2™
Bridge Pickup
ProBucker-3™
Controls
Bridge Volume with coil-splittingNeck Volume with coil-splittingBridge ToneNeck Tone
Bridge
LockTone™ Tune-o-matic
Tailpiece
StopBar
Truss Rod Cover
2-ply; (Black/White); Vintage “E” in White
Hardware
Gold
Machine Heads
Grover® Rotomatics™, 18:1 ratio
Strings
D’Addario® 10-46 gauge
Colors
Vintage Sunburst, Ebony, Natural, Wine Red
